Notes
Death
Mrs. Madge Logan Furr of Dougalsville passed away Saturday. She is survived by three sons, Mr. C. J. Furr of Douglasville; Mr. W. T. Furr, Mr. Johnnie Powell of Atlanta; two daughters, Mrs. Clyde Johnston of Powder Springs, Mrs. F. T. Sane of Atlanta; several grandchildren and great-grandchildren; brothers, Mr. Alec Logan of Douglasville, Mr. Maye Logan of Marietta, Mr. Glen Logan of Palmetto; sisters, Mrs. Lola Evans, Mrs. Nell Shay, Marietta; Mrs. Bessie Rainwater, Palmetto; Mrs. Ida Parson, Atlanta. Funeral services will be held Monday at 2 p.m. from Pleasant Hill Baptist Church. Rev. Paul Carter and Rev. Fred Johnsa will officiate. Interment, Friendship Primitive Baptist churchyard, Paulding County. Pallbearers please meet at the residence at 1 o'clock. Roy Davis Funeral Home, Austell.The Atlanta Journal Constitution, Atlanta, Georgia, March 1, 1957
